bank account details are for SELLING not buying,

 

 

adding your bank details to enable ebay to give you the money you make when you sell something has nothing to do with how you pay for items

 

 

buyers can still use paypal to buy, and if you use the remember me option paypal will automatically pay for items without you needing to log into your paypal account, if you don't want this to happen you need to turn it off in your paypal account

 

if you share your computer you need to make sure you log out of ebay and don't save the passwords, that way only you can access your ebay account
